Have You Seen Him: Jerry Wayne Louis Is Wanted By Police

Police and the state attorney general's office is looking for Jerry Wayne Louis, 54, who is wanted for child indecency.

HUMBLE, TX — The Harris County Sheriff's Office, the Texas Attorney General's Office, and Crime Stoppers are looking for a Jerry Wayne Louis.

Police said Louis is on the run and is wanted for indecency with a child. He has an active warrant for his arrest through the Harris County Sheriff's Office.

Officials said Louis is an independent paving contractor and is believed to be working in the greater Houston area, and possibly in Humble.

Fugitive Louis is a white male, 54-years-old, approximately 5-feet-10, and 260 pounds. Louis has hazel eyes, and has short brown and gray hair. He has various alias names which include: Steve Davis, Darryl Rickey, and James Johnson.

Crime Stoppers may pay up to $5,000 for information leading to his arrest. Anyone who knows where he is, should call Crime Stoppers at 713-222-TIPS (8477).
